新手入门学习的常见难题
许多新手在学习新知识或使用新工具时,常常会面临找不到入口、不知从何开始的困境。这主要是因为信息冗杂,缺乏清晰的引导路径,导致学习者迷失方向,难以建立起对整体知识体系的理解。这种现象在学习编程、使用新软件、掌握新技能等方面尤为突出。本文将提供一个通用的教学模型新手克服这一难题,快速进入学习状态。
教学模型:循序渐进,由浅入深
本教学模型的核心思想是循序渐进,由浅入深,将复杂的知识体系分解成易于理解和掌握的小模块。通过设置清晰的学习路径和目标,引导新手逐步掌握知识,最终达到熟练应用的水平。
阶段一:明确目标与概述
在学习开始之前,必须明确学习目标。这将有助于新手集中注意力,避免学习过程中的迷茫。同时,需要对整个学习内容进行概述,让新手对整体知识体系有一个初步的了解,从而建立起学习框架。
阶段二:分解学习内容
将庞大的学习内容分解成若干个小的、易于理解的模块。每个模块设置明确的学习目标和练习新手逐步掌握知识点。例如,学习编程可以先从基础语法开始,再逐步学习函数、面向对象编程等高级概念。
阶段三:提供实践机会
理论学习固然重要,但实践才是检验学习成果的最佳途径。在每个学习模块之后,都应该提供相应的练习或实践机会新手巩固知识,并及时发现和纠正学习过程中的错误。
阶段四:及时反馈与调整
学习过程中,及时反馈至关重要。新手需要得到及时的指导和反馈,以便及时发现学习中的问题并进行调整。这可以通过与老师或学习伙伴交流,或者通过自测等方式来实现。通过持续的反馈和调整,新手可以不断提升学习效率,最终达到学习目标。
阶段五:持续学习与精进
学习是一个持续的过程,不能一蹴而就。新手需要养成持续学习的习惯,不断巩固已掌握的知识,并学习新的知识。通过持续学习和精进,才能在相关领域达到更高的水平。
教学资源与工具的选择
选择合适的教学资源和工具也是至关重要的。例如,选择清晰易懂的教材、视频教程或在线课程,以及合适的练习平台。这些资源应该能够有效地引导新手他们快速上手。
案例分析:学习编程
以学习编程为例,新手可以先从学习简单的编程语言(如Python)开始,学习基础语法和数据结构。然后逐步学习算法、数据库等更高级的概念。在学习过程中,可以利用在线编程平台进行练习,并积极参与开源项目,获得实践经验。
结语
总而言之新手找到学习入口的关键在于设计一个清晰、易于理解的教学模型,并提供足够的实践机会和反馈。通过循序渐进的学习方式,新手可以克服学习过程中的困难,最终达到学习目标。
常见问题解答
Q: 如果遇到问题不知道如何解决怎么办?
A: 可以寻求帮助,例如向老师、同学或在线社区寻求帮助。也可以通过阅读相关文档或搜索引擎查找答案。
Q: 如何保持学习动力?
A: 设定明确的目标,并定期回顾学习进度。找到学习的乐趣,并与其他学习者交流经验。
Q: 学习时间安排如何规划?
A: 根据自身情况合理安排学习时间,避免过度学习导致疲劳。